Guests Donn and Andy Corder discuss with Mindy how Cancer impacted their lives and what Bag iT Guiding them through Cancer meant to them!

Andy - I was born in Albuquerque, New Mexico. I entered the United States Air Force and served for 20 years. My previous wife, Tina, died from cancer in 1990, leaving me a single parent of 3 young children. I later met and married my wife Donn. In 2008, I was ordained as a Deacon in the Roman Catholic Church. In 2011, I was diagnosed with Esophageal Cancer and I spent the next two years in some form of curative therapy (Radiation, Chemo and Physical).

Donn - Born and raised in Ohio.   After graduation, I entered the USAF.  When I married a widower with three young children I chose to separate from the USAF and be a full-time Mom.  Three days after our 20th Anniversary, Andy was diagnosed with esophageal cancer.  A friend gave us a Bag It.  Outside of prayer, it was the best gift we got during his illness.  I had no cancer experience and had no idea of how to cope with this illness.  The Bag It provided me with such great information and helped me be a better advocate for us.
